Team News
Ziyad Larkeche, Scott Fraser, Clark Robertson, Joe Shaughnessy and Antonio Portales are all out for a Dundee side decimated by injuries.
Jordan McGhee and Billy Koumetio were both forced off the field against St Mirren at the weekend and are now major doubts. Luke Graham has been recalled from a loan move at Falkrik and should be available.
Louis Moult and Craig Sibbald will miss the short trip to Dens Park, but Declan Gallagher is back from suspension.

Dundee have won only five of their last 18 matches and the Dark Blues are in freefall. Docherty’s side arrested the slide when beating St Mirren last time out, but it could be derby day pain for Dundee.
Injuries have played a major part in the Dark Blues’ downfall, with a whole host of first-team players out injured and centre-back duo Jordan McGhee and Billy Koumetio were both forced off the field against St Mirren at the weekend, to make matters worse.
Docherty lost star midfielder Luke McCowan to Celtic in August and it’s looking like a threadbare Dundee squad.
Dundee United are pushing hard for a top-three finish this season and the Terrors have impressed in recent wins over St Johnstone and Aberdeen.
The Tangerines should be able to take advantage of a depleted Dundee squad and secure derby day honours.
